- Value Leadership: According to GlobalData's latest rankings, Barclays led the financial services M&A advisory in Q1 2026 with $31.4 billion in deal value, showcasing its strong market influence.
- Volume Performance: Houlihan Lokey ranked first by deal count with 15 transactions, maintaining its position from the previous year, reflecting its sustained trust among clients despite no increase in deal volume.
- Competitor Analysis: Morgan Stanley secured the second position with $27.9 billion in advised deals, indicating robust performance in the advisory sector, while Goldman Sachs and Lazard followed closely with $26.8 billion and $25.6 billion respectively, highlighting intense competition.
- Barclays' Significant Growth: Compared to Q1 2025, Barclays experienced a more than seven-fold increase in total deal value, successfully rising from eighth to first place, demonstrating effective strategies in securing large transactions, particularly two mega deals exceeding $10 billion.

About HLI
Houlihan Lokey, Inc. is a global investment bank specializing in mergers and acquisitions, capital solutions, financial restructuring, and financial and valuation advisory. Its segments include Corporate Finance (CF), Financial Restructuring (FR), and Financial and Valuation Advisory (FVA). CF segment provides general financial advisory services and advice on mergers and acquisitions and capital solutions offerings. FR segment offers a range of advisory services to its clients, including: the structuring, negotiation, and confirmation of plans of reorganization; liability management transactions; corporate viability assessment, and procuring debtor-in-possession financing. FVA segment provides financial advisory and valuation services with respect to companies, debt and equity interests (including complex illiquid investments), and other types of assets and liabilities, and others. It also provides investment banking advice to clients in the insurance and wealth management sectors.

- New Managing Director: Eric Crowley has joined Houlihan Lokey as a Managing Director in the Global Technology Group, focusing on consumer subscription software, consumer technology, and ad-tech sectors, which is expected to enhance the firm's market competitiveness.
- Extensive Industry Experience: With over a decade of investment banking and operational experience, Crowley previously led the Consumer Technology practice at GP Bullhound, advising on high-profile M&A transactions, thereby strengthening the firm's industry influence.
- Global Technology Team Strength: Houlihan Lokey's Technology Group is ranked No. 1 globally in M&A advisory, with nearly 150 finance professionals and over 25 managing directors, showcasing strong industry coverage and resource integration capabilities.
- Achieving Strategic Goals: Crowley expressed excitement about collaborating with the global team to help clients achieve their strategic objectives in a rapidly evolving market, further solidifying Houlihan Lokey's leadership position in technology consulting.

- Earnings Announcement Date: Houlihan Lokey (HLI) is set to release its Q4 earnings on May 6 after market close, with a consensus EPS estimate of $1.79, reflecting an 8.7% year-over-year decline, which may impact investor confidence in the company's future performance.
- Revenue Expectations: The revenue estimate stands at $679.02 million, indicating a modest 1.9% year-over-year growth, which, while limited, demonstrates the company's stability in the market and may attract investors looking for reliable opportunities.
- Historical Performance: HLI has consistently beaten EPS and revenue estimates 100% of the time over the past two years, a track record that could bolster market confidence in its financial health, despite recent downward revisions indicating some pressure on expectations.
- Revision Trends: Over the last three months, EPS estimates have seen one upward revision and eight downward adjustments, while revenue estimates have experienced no upward revisions and seven downward changes, suggesting a weakening outlook for the company's growth potential, which could affect stock performance.

- M&A Advisory Ranking: According to GlobalData's latest league table, Goldman Sachs emerged as the leading M&A adviser in North America for Q1 2026, advising on transactions worth a total of $189 billion, showcasing its significant market influence.
- Deal Volume Comparison: While Houlihan Lokey led by number of mandates with 56 deals, Goldman Sachs closely followed with 33 deals, indicating its strength in high-value transactions, particularly in large-scale deals.
- Significant Growth Rate: Goldman Sachs experienced a remarkable 60.8% increase in total deal value in Q1 2026 compared to the same period in 2025, which not only improved its ranking by value but also reflected its growing competitiveness in the market.
- Participation in Mega Deals: In this quarter, Goldman Sachs was involved in 18 billion-dollar deals, including five mega deals valued over $10 billion, significantly boosting its performance and reinforcing its position as a top adviser in high-stakes transactions.
